Position Summary
As a member of the Pharmacy Division Senior Management Team, the post holder will be responsible for delivering the strategic aims of the Division primarily linked to operational planning and service delivery that is patient focused, safe and regulatory compliant. This will ensure smooth and efficient operations, performance and outcomes management of these high‑risk activities by leading operational teams to achieve this.
Key Responsibilities
The role will be responsible for a portfolio of service delivery with operational service level agreements, contracts and policy across a range of services and providers throughout the division.
Lead on service delivery to all stakeholders within NHS Wales and externally, ensuring customer satisfaction and excellence while identifying cost benefits and efficiencies.
Ensure business continuity with strategic planning for service resilience on behalf of the Director of Pharmacy Services.
Lead on each Pharmacy Division section/department’s commercial plans and their performance with outcomes measurement and reporting to ensure they reflect the organisation’s annual delivery plan and strategies as set out within its IMTP.
Strategically plan, execute and monitor all aspects of divisional projects to realise intended outcomes in line with division and organisational goals aligned to the IMTP and clinical demand for medicines and pharmacy services.
Lead on business continuity planning for robust responses to incidents and disruptions, including business impact analysis, risk assessment and development of continuity plans to include emergency responses and back‑up systems.
Lead on strategic planning for service resilience, design of flexible and adaptable service delivery models with continuous monitoring of performance against KPIs, updates to current systems and practices, or implementation of new or novel solutions to manage risks, maintaining risk registers, ensuring appropriate governance and escalation.
Lead on the design and implementation of digital workflow systems and digital dashboard systems to demonstrate operational performance.
